Abstract

691,127. Luminescent materials. THOR N ELECTRICAL INDUSTRIES, Ltd. Sept. 13, 1950 [Sept. 13, 1949], No. 22551/50. Class 39(i). A method of preparing a luminescent calcium halophosphate phosphor containing combined chlorine as chloride, comprises firing a mixture of ingredients in which substantially all chloride present is in the form of ammonium chloride. In an example described ammonium chloride, calcium carbonate, secondary calcium phosphate, antimony oxide or an antimony salt which can be reduced to the oxide on firing and if desired a manganous salt (manganous carbonate referred to) which can be reduced to the oxide on firing, and calcium fluoride are intimately mixed and fired. Proportions of constituents are given. The gram atom ratio of calcium plus manganese to phosphorus should be about 4.85 to 3 for maximum brightness. The mixture is fired, preferably in covered crucibles, at 1090‹C for 6 hours and the resulting mass is powdered and, if necessary, milled. The secondary calcium phosphate is prepared as described in Specification 684,025. The emission colour is approximately 3500‹K white.
